Ambiance component refers to a part or element that contributes to the overall atmosphere or mood of a space. There are several synonyms for this term, such as environmental factor, contextual aspect, and atmospheric element. Other related words include vibe enhancer, milieu feature, and setting detail. All of these terms describe the different components that can impact the ambiance of a room or environment. From lighting and sound to furniture and decor, every aspect plays a role in creating a cohesive and desirable ambiance. By paying attention to ambiance components, designers and decorators can create spaces that feel welcoming, comfortable, and memorable.
